Libanan said that the order to blacklist Julian Simone was based on the complaint filed by Loreto Trocio and his wife Marilou before the Department of Foreign Affairs.DFA Assistant Secretary Renato Villapando told the BI that a foreign service circular was sent out to all Philippine missions abroad with the instruction not to issue any visa to Simone.In a statement, the BI said that the foreigner fell into the category of undesirable alien after the couple complained of unjust labor practices against him. Simone was their former employer who allegedly forced them to work long hours in his hotel in Australia and given low salaryLink to the whole storyNow it seems that even what you get accused of doing back in your home country can get you banned from entry into the Philippines.
